I know similar problems have been posted but I still can't quite get this worked out.
I transferred all my files from my hard drive to an external drive as I had to reformat my hard drive.
I've dragged coreftp back on to my C: drive now but can't seem to get my old file list up.
Is there a file somewhere than I can simply copy from my external drive to somewhere on my C: drive to bring this list back?

http://www.coreftp.com/faq/#Cat19
default settings put them in the registry. Right clicking on the site list in the Site Manager, then choosing "Reindex Sites" may restore them too.
